在IT行业中,尤其是在Web开发领域,常常需要处理数据的导入导出操作,特别是将数据导出为用户易于处理和分析的格式,如Excel。在ASP.NET框架下,使用内置的功能来实现复杂的数据导出可能较为繁琐,这时第三方控件就显得尤为重要。"myxls"是一个这样的控件,它专门用于帮助开发者方便地将数据导出到Excel中。
myxls控件是一个高效且功能强大的工具,它可以简化ASP.NET应用程序中的Excel文件生成过程。它提供了丰富的API和方法,使得开发者可以轻松地设置单元格的样式、格式数据、添加图表等各种功能,从而创建出符合需求的Excel工作簿。
使用myxls控件时,首先需要在项目中引入相关的DLL文件,这个压缩包中包含了名为"MyXls的Dll文件"的部分,这些文件是myxls控件的核心组件,它们包含了实现Excel导出所需的所有类库。通过引用这些DLL,开发者可以在代码中调用myxls提供的方法,例如创建工作表、写入数据、设置格式等。
在ASP.NET项目中集成myxls控件通常涉及以下几个步骤:
1. 将"MyXls的Dll文件"添加到项目的引用中:在Visual Studio中,右键点击项目 -> "添加引用" -> 浏览找到DLL文件并添加。
2. 引入相关命名空间:在代码文件中,使用`using`语句引入myxls的命名空间,以便访问其类和方法。
3. 创建Excel工作簿对象:实例化myxls提供的类,如`MyXls.Excel`,创建一个新的Excel工作簿。
4. 添加工作表:调用工作簿对象的方法,如`AddSheet()`,来创建新的工作表。
5. 写入数据:通过工作表对象,可以使用`SetCell()`或类似方法将数据写入到指定的单元格。
6. 设置格式:可以使用`SetCellStyle()`等方法设置单元格、行或列的样式,包括字体、颜色、边框等。
7. 保存文件:使用`SaveAs()`方法将工作簿保存为Excel文件,可以选择保存到服务器或者直接返回给客户端下载。
除了基本的导出功能,myxls控件还支持一些高级特性,例如:
- 处理大数据量:myxls能够高效处理大量数据,避免内存溢出问题。
- 图表支持:可以创建各种类型的图表,如柱状图、折线图等,帮助用户直观理解数据。
- 自定义样式:支持自定义单元格样式,如合并单元格、设置背景色、条件格式等。
- 数据验证:可以设置数据验证规则,限制用户输入的数据类型和范围。
在实际应用中,为了便于其他开发者理解和使用,可以创建一个简单的示例网站,这就是"myxls"压缩包中的"myXLSWebSite"。这个网站可能包含了一个或多个ASP.NET页面,演示了如何在实际的Web环境中使用myxls控件导出数据到Excel。
总结来说,myxls控件是ASP.NET开发中一个实用的工具,它极大地简化了数据导出到Excel的过程,提供了丰富的功能和易用的API,能够帮助开发者快速实现数据导出的需求,提升开发效率。通过学习和熟练掌握myxls的使用,可以更好地满足用户对数据处理和分析的需求。
- 1
- 2
- 3
- 4
前往页